Zulum begins construction of ring road Maiduguri

[FILES] Zulum
Governor Babagana Zulum of Borno State has commenced the construction of the 113-kilometre Maiduguri metropolis ring road project.

According to him, the East, West and South ring road will link Auno, Molai, Polo and Shagari low-cost communities.

Flagging off the project, yesterday, in Maiduguri, the governor disclosed: “Today’s event was to begin Maiduguri urban renewal drive that was on the drawing board of the Ministry of Works and Housing.”


According to him, the project, which is part of his urban renewal drive, will address the challenge of traffic gridlocks in Maiduguri city.

He noted that decongesting the city could also address the housing deficits with the creation of job opportunities for economic growth.

Zulum said: “The state government is to execute the ring road in phases, commencing with the Maiduguri-Kano-Monguno-Gubio roads covering 16 kilometres.”

He, however, lamented the massive influx of Internally Displaced Persons (IDPs) into the Maiduguri metropolis.

“They have been putting a lot of pressure on housing and other existing infrastructure of Maiduguri,” he said, adding that the government is taking deliberate steps to decongest the city.
